CBSE Class 12 Hindi Course 2025-26 has been designed by CBSE Board to increase the efficiency of students in Hindi language and to deepen the appreciation of its rich literary heritage. The syllabus is based on the recommended books, Antra and Antral, which has a diverse collection of attractive poems, stories, essays, plays and biographical texts. These literary literature promote overall language skills including reading, writing, listening and speaking in a pleasant and interactive way.
Grammar, vocabulary enhancement and advanced aspects of sentence structure have been integrated to help students express their fluent and effective expression. Activity-based teaching and understanding exercises encourage clear communication and important thinking.
The CBSE Class 12 Hindi Course generates an active and learning environment for teaching, assisting students to create a solid language and literary foundation. This foundation is useful not only to do well in board examinations but will also assist students in higher studies and competitive examinations for which Hindi is necessary.
